Output 84f9c6ce067d0b6d3a619b1d319f0126af3f184be04d432283850f56f2a05a80:2

value
1052499
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3555bd65f71def396a609a9fe388958b9e694bde7ccbc4d22c27ce5cd2fdeeb5
address
tb1px42m6e0hrhhnj6nqn2078zy43w0xjj770n9uf53vyl89e5haa66slpmtn9
transaction
84f9c6ce067d0b6d3a619b1d319f0126af3f184be04d432283850f56f2a05a80
confirmations
25717
spent
true